titleOfInvention Method for producing 1,2-benzisothiazolin-3-one compound
abstract The present invention provides a method for producing a 1,2-benzisothiazolin-3-one compound easily and economically with high purity and high yield. A reaction mixture obtained by reacting a 2- (alkylthio) benzonitrile compound and a halogenating agent in the presence of water is maintained at a low temperature of about -20 ° C to 40 ° C, and the resulting solid is obtained.
